The Karnak Temple
After being picked up, you'll head to Luxor to visit the renowned Karnak Temple. Explore the vast complex of temples, halls, and columns dedicated to various deities of ancient Egypt. Marvel at the grandeur of this magnificent site.
90 minutes here · Admission included
Colossi of Memnon
Behold the impressive Colossi of Memnon, two massive stone statues that are the remnants of the Temple of Amenophis III. Learn about their historical significance.
30 minutes here
Luxor
Savor a delicious lunch at a local restaurant, refueling for the rest of your adventure.
60 minutes here
Valley of the Kings
Discover the extensive complex of 63 royal tombs. Explore the Valley of the Kings, where the treasures of King Tutankhamun, including his original accessories, were unearthed. Admire the hieroglyphic inscriptions that narrate the stories of each king.
120 minutes here · Admission included
Temple of Hatshepsut
Explore the striking architecture of the Valley of the Kings and visit the Temple of Hatshepsut. Hatshepsut, one of Egypt's female rulers, is known for her remarkable reign and monuments.
120 minutes here · Admission included
